TENUGUI is often introduced to tools as hand towel, but actually TENUGUI is not only hand towel but is tools that have various uses. For example, wrap things, roll own head up when they take part in festival...
It is TENUGUI that not to sew up an edge tightly, but it would not become loose if you would wash it well.

TSUMAMI is Japanese traditional decorative Kanzashi mainly. (nowadays, sometimes Tsumami is used as accessory)
Kanzashi means ornamental hairpin.
Kanzashi is the word that was corrupted from "Kami Sashi (insert into hair)".
Ancient Japanese people believed that something pointed has sorcery power. So, especially women had it as an amulet. Actually, Kanzashi became a weapon instead of sword for women.
Kanzashi itself has long long history, but TSUMAMI Kanzashi (one of Kanzashi) was produced in the latter of Edo period (1837 - 1853).

TSUMAMI is one of Kanzashi which is using crepe and silk cloths. Flowers and birds are expressed with these little cloths. It's very sophisticated works.

TSUMAMI let us feel a sweet beauty, tenderly and beautiful seasons.

We can see TSUMAMI at old Ukiyoe (wood block print).

Unfortunately, antique TSUMAMI, however, are not remaining except metal part. Because the materials of TSUMAMI are cloths, paper and starchy paste (not suited for preservation).
Contemporary TSUMAMI are able to preserve. Because the quality of materials are raised good.

MAIKO are usually using TSUMAMI still now. TSUMAMI is a beautiful traditional item for MAIKO. You can see them at Kyoto.
By the way, we have a bad news about TSUMAMI.
TSUMAMI craftsmen are decreasing now. Especially, supreme artisan who is authorized from Tokyo metropolitan government are TWO!!
I mean, if they are gone, TSUMAMI culture would be gone. And MAIKO culture would be decline in the near future, too.

Fudoh Myouou is Buddhism images that is the most believed in Japan!
Originally, Fudou's name is Acala Naatha in India.
Fudou and Acala Naatha means "The Immovable One".
His face is angry one. but he saves people by force.
Fudoh Myouou is Buddhism images that is the most believed in Japan than any other Buddhism areas!
Actually, there are many temples that Fudoh exists in Japan.
(The most famous temple is Naritasan Shinsho-ji temple near Narita International Airport.)

- What's KOGO-BUTSU?
Originally, KOGO was a container of incense among noble calass.
Following at the time, Buddha has been carved inside of KOGO. That is portable sculpture of Buddha.
Traveler used to bring it, or put it and decorate it in own room as a charm.
It made of boxwood.
About AIZEN Myo-Oh
In Buddhism, Buddha has transformed various figures to let people believe in the concept.
Aizen Myo-Oh is one of them.
Buddhism says "Human being has 108 desires". And Buddha says "If we abandon these desires, everybody would be able to be Buddha."
However we can not abandon desires easily like Buddha. So Buddha lead us to Buddha by force.
Buddha's rage is sign of affection. Then Buddha uses the power of love.
For that reason, Aizen Myo-Oh is recognized as symbol of love and Aizen is believed by many people.
